> A small group can not be cognizant of how 700 documents are
> being  used in the field years afterwards.  Although ISDs
> offered a  solution, the administrative attention needed for
> reviewing an  aggregation of modified dated material is still
> likely best placed on  material related to current issues.
> However ISDs, by providing a  stable reference, offered
> significant value.
> 
>> As far as the structure of the RFC indexes are concerned,
>> that's an   operational matter that I believe is best
>> arranged directly with   the RFC Editor as part of the future
>> contract (you will recall that   the RFP for that contract
>> has been issued).
> 
> More than just a set of indexes is needed.  Composing a
> structure  retaining the ISD reference feature will likely
> produce a greater  impact on a set of document's stature than
> would RFC2026 categories.   While this effort could become a
> task for the RFC editor, it seems  defining a suitable
> structure would be something of general  interest.  The goal
> would be to ensure a relational structure is  created by
> interested parties in the earliest stages of a document's
> development; a cradle to grave method for tracking endeavours,
> rather  than just individual documents.
